 | static void | 
 | ngx_ssl_stapling_ocsp_handler(ngx_ssl_ocsp_ctx_t *ctx) | 
 | { | 
 |     time_t               now; | 
 |     ngx_str_t            response; | 
 |     ngx_ssl_stapling_t  *staple; | 
 |  | 
 |     staple = ctx->data; | 
 |     now = ngx_time(); | 
 |  | 
 |     if (ngx_ssl_ocsp_verify(ctx) != NGX_OK) { |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     if (ctx->status != V_OCSP_CERTSTATUS_GOOD) { | 
 |         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_ERR,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"certificate status \"%s\" in the OCSP response", | 
 |                       OCSP_cert_status_str(ctx->status));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     /* copy the response to memory not in ctx->pool */ | 
 |  | 
 |     response.len = ctx->response->last - ctx->response->pos; | 
 |     response.data = ngx_alloc(response.len, ctx->log); | 
 |  | 
 |     if (response.data == NULL) { |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     ngx_memcpy(response.data, ctx->response->pos, response.len); | 
 |  | 
 |     if (staple->staple.data) { | 
 |         ngx_free(staple->staple.data); |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     staple->staple = response; | 
 |     staple->valid = ctx->valid; | 
 |  | 
 |     /* | 
 |      * refresh before the response expires, | 
 |      * but not earlier than in 5 minutes, and at least in an hour | 
 |      */ | 
 |  | 
 |     staple->loading = 0; | 
 |     staple->refresh = ngx_max(ngx_min(ctx->valid - 300, now + 3600), now + 300); | 
 |  | 
 |     ngx_ssl_ocsp_done(ctx); | 
 |     return; | 
 |  | 
 | error: | 
 |  | 
 |     staple->loading = 0; | 
 |     staple->refresh = now + 300; | 
 |  | 
 |     ngx_ssl_ocsp_done(ctx); | 
 | } |

 | static time_t | 
 | ngx_ssl_stapling_time(ASN1_GENERALIZEDTIME *asn1time) | 
 | { | 
 |     BIO     *bio; | 
 |     char    *value; | 
 |     size_t   len; | 
 |     time_t   time; | 
 |  | 
 |     /* | 
 |      * OpenSSL doesn't provide a way to convert ASN1_GENERALIZEDTIME | 
 |      * into time_t.  To do this, we use ASN1_GENERALIZEDTIME_print(), | 
 |      * which uses the "MMM DD HH:MM:SS YYYY [GMT]" format (e.g., | 
 |      * "Feb  3 00:55:52 2015 GMT"), and parse the result. | 
 |      */ | 
 |  | 
 |     bio = BIO_new(BIO_s_mem()); | 
 |     if (bio == NULL) { | 
 |         return NGX_ERROR;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     /* fake weekday prepended to match C asctime() format */ | 
 |  | 
 |     BIO_write(bio, "Tue ", sizeof("Tue ") - 1); | 
 |     ASN1_GENERALIZEDTIME_print(bio, asn1time); | 
 |     len = BIO_get_mem_data(bio, &value); | 
 |  | 
 |     time = ngx_parse_http_time((u_char *) value, len); | 
 |  | 
 |     BIO_free(bio); | 
 |  | 
 |     return time; | 
 | } |

 | static ngx_int_t | 
 | ngx_ssl_ocsp_verify(ngx_ssl_ocsp_ctx_t *ctx) | 
 | { | 
 |     int                    n; | 
 |     size_t                 len; | 
 |     X509_STORE            *store; | 
 |     const u_char          *p; | 
 |     OCSP_CERTID           *id; | 
 |     OCSP_RESPONSE         *ocsp; | 
 |     OCSP_BASICRESP        *basic; | 
 |     ASN1_GENERALIZEDTIME  *thisupdate, *nextupdate; | 
 |  | 
 |     ocsp = NULL; | 
 |     basic = NULL; | 
 |     id = NULL; | 
 |  | 
 |     if (ctx->code != 200) { |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     /* check the response */ | 
 |  | 
 |     len = ctx->response->last - ctx->response->pos; | 
 |     p = ctx->response->pos; | 
 |  | 
 |     ocsp = d2i_OCSP_RESPONSE(NULL, &p, len); | 
 |     if (ocsp == NULL) { | 
 |         ngx_ssl_error(NGX_LOG_ERR,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"d2i_OCSP_RESPONSE() failed");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     n = OCSP_response_status(ocsp); | 
 |  | 
 |     if (n != OCSP_RESPONSE_STATUS_SUCCESSFUL) { | 
 |         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_ERR,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"OCSP response not successful (%d: %s)", | 
 |                       n, OCSP_response_status_str(n));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     basic = OCSP_response_get1_basic(ocsp); | 
 |     if (basic == NULL) { | 
 |         ngx_ssl_error(NGX_LOG_ERR,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"OCSP_response_get1_basic() failed");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     store = SSL_CTX_get_cert_store(ctx->ssl_ctx); | 
 |     if (store == NULL) { | 
 |         ngx_ssl_error(NGX_LOG_CRIT,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"SSL_CTX_get_cert_store() failed");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     if (OCSP_basic_verify(basic, ctx->chain, store, ctx->flags) != 1) { | 
 |         ngx_ssl_error(NGX_LOG_ERR,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"OCSP_basic_verify() failed");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     id = OCSP_cert_to_id(NULL, ctx->cert, ctx->issuer); | 
 |     if (id == NULL) { | 
 |         ngx_ssl_error(NGX_LOG_CRIT,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"OCSP_cert_to_id() failed");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     if (OCSP_resp_find_status(basic, id, &ctx->status, NULL, NULL, | 
 |                               &thisupdate, &nextupdate) | 
 |         != 1) | 
 |     { | 
 |         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_ERR,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"certificate status not found in the OCSP response");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     if (OCSP_check_validity(thisupdate, nextupdate, 300, -1) != 1) { | 
 |         ngx_ssl_error(NGX_LOG_ERR,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                       "OCSP_check_validity() failed"); | 
 |         goto error;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     if (nextupdate) { | 
 |         ctx->valid = ngx_ssl_stapling_time(nextupdate); | 
 |         if (ctx->valid == (time_t) NGX_ERROR) { | 
 |             ngx_log_error(NGX_LOG_ERR,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                           "invalid nextUpdate time in certificate status"); | 
 |             goto error; | 
 |         } | 
 |  | 
 |     } else { | 
 |         ctx->valid = NGX_MAX_TIME_T_VALUE;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     OCSP_CERTID_free(id); | 
 |     OCSP_BASICRESP_free(basic); | 
 |     OCSP_RESPONSE_free(ocsp); | 
 |  | 
 |     ngx_log_debug2(NGX_LOG_DEBUG_EVENT, ctx->log, 0, | 
 |                    "ssl ocsp response, %s, %uz", | 
 |                    OCSP_cert_status_str(ctx->status), len); | 
 |  | 
 |     return NGX_OK; | 
 |  | 
 | error: | 
 |  | 
 |     if (id) { | 
 |         OCSP_CERTID_free(id); |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     if (basic) { | 
 |         OCSP_BASICRESP_free(basic); |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     if (ocsp) { | 
 |         OCSP_RESPONSE_free(ocsp); |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     return NGX_ERROR; | 
 | } |
